The Highway Loss Data Institute, an affiliate of the Insurance Institute of Highway Safety, has revealed the Cadillac Escalade had the highest rate of insurance theft claims for the fourth year in a row. About a quarter of the claims were for over $40,000, which means that thieves were often jacking the whole giant SUV instead of just pilfering it for parts. The actual data revealed that theft claims were issues for 13.2 out of every 1,000 units sold. The runner-up was the Mistubishi Lancer Evo and then the Dodge Ram 1500 Quad Cab. The least attractive vehicles in the eyes of thieves were the Ford Taurus, Pontiac Vibe, Buick LeSabre and Park Avenue.
